One of 26 sculptures in the sculpture garden - this piece was created by British sculptor Henry Moore (1898-1986). The piece was cast at the Noack Foundry in Berlin in 1973, and was subsequently purchased by the National Gallery of Australia in 1975.
Title: Hill Arches

Artist: Henry Moore

Media (materials) used: bronze

Location (specific park, transit center, library, etc.): Sculpture Garden at National Gallery of Australia

Date of creation or placement: 1973 (placed 1975)
